| applyMask(const Image< char > &mask) | lsseg::Image< double > | [inline] |
| begin() | lsseg::Image< double > | [inline] |
| begin() const | lsseg::Image< double > | [inline] |
| cached_ | lsseg::LevelSetFunction | [mutable, private] |
| channelBegin(int channel) | lsseg::Image< double > | [inline] |
| channelBegin(int channel) const | lsseg::Image< double > | [inline] |
| channelEnd(int channel) | lsseg::Image< double > | [inline] |
| channelEnd(int channel) const | lsseg::Image< double > | [inline] |
| channelSize() const | lsseg::Image< double > | [inline] |
| curvature2D(int x, int y) const | lsseg::LevelSetFunction | [inline] |
| curvature2D(Image< double > &target, Mask *mask=0) const | lsseg::LevelSetFunction | [inline] |
| curvature3D(int x, int y, int z) const | lsseg::LevelSetFunction | [inline] |
| curvature3D(Image< double > &target, Mask *mask=0) const | lsseg::LevelSetFunction | [inline] |
| curvatureTimesGrad2D(Image< double > &target, Mask *mask=0) const | lsseg::LevelSetFunction | [inline] |
| curvatureTimesGrad2D(int x, int y) const | lsseg::LevelSetFunction | [inline] |
| curvatureTimesGrad3D(int x, int y, int z) const | lsseg::LevelSetFunction | [inline] |
| curvatureTimesGrad3D(Image< double > &target, Mask *mask=0) const | lsseg::LevelSetFunction | [inline] |
| data_ | lsseg::Image< double > | [protected] |
| dim_ | lsseg::Image< double > | [protected] |
| dimx() const | lsseg::Image< double > | [inline] |
| dimy() const | lsseg::Image< double > | [inline] |
| dimz() const | lsseg::Image< double > | [inline] |
| dumpInfo(std::ostream &os) const | lsseg::Image< double > | [inline] |
| end() | lsseg::Image< double > | [inline] |
| end() const | lsseg::Image< double > | [inline] |
| fill(doubleval) | lsseg::Image< double > | [inline] |
| getAverage() const | lsseg::Image< double > | [inline] |
| gradientNorm2D(int x, int y) const | lsseg::LevelSetFunction | [inline] |
| gradientNorm2D(Image< double > &target, Mask *mask=0) const | lsseg::LevelSetFunction | [inline] |
| gradientNorm3D(int x, int y, int z) const | lsseg::LevelSetFunction | [inline] |
| gradientNorm3D(Image< double > &target, Mask *mask=0) const | lsseg::LevelSetFunction | [inline] |
| graySize2D() const | lsseg::Image< double > | [inline] |
| Image() | lsseg::Image< double > | [inline] |
| Image(int x, int y, int z=1, int chan=1, doublefill_val=0) | lsseg::Image< double > | [inline] |
| Image(const Image< U > &rhs) | lsseg::Image< double > | [inline] |
| Image(const Image< double > &rhs) | lsseg::Image< double > | [inline] |
| Image(const Image< U > &rhs, bool copy) | lsseg::Image< double > | [inline] |
| indexOf(int x, int y) const | lsseg::Image< double > | [inline] |
| indexOf(int x, int y, int z) const | lsseg::Image< double > | [inline] |
| indexOf(int x, int y, int z, int c) const | lsseg::Image< double > | [inline] |
| intersect(const Image< double > &img) | lsseg::Image< double > | [inline] |
| LevelSetFunction() | lsseg::LevelSetFunction | [inline] |
| LevelSetFunction(int x, int y, int z=1, double val=0) | lsseg::LevelSetFunction | [inline] |
| LevelSetFunction(const LevelSetFunction &rhs) | lsseg::LevelSetFunction | [inline] |
| LevelSetFunction(const LevelSetFunction &rhs, bool copy) | lsseg::LevelSetFunction | [inline] |
| makeChannelImage(Image< double > &target, int ch) | lsseg::Image< double > | [inline] |
| max() const | lsseg::Image< double > | [inline] |
| min() const | lsseg::Image< double > | [inline] |
| numChannels() const | lsseg::Image< double > | [inline] |
| operator *=(doublea) | lsseg::Image< double > | [inline] |
| operator()(int x, int y) | lsseg::Image< double > | [inline] |
| operator()(int x, int y, int z) | lsseg::Image< double > | [inline] |
| operator()(int x, int y, int z, int c) | lsseg::Image< double > | [inline] |
| operator()(int x, int y) const | lsseg::Image< double > | [inline] |
| operator()(int x, int y, int z) const | lsseg::Image< double > | [inline] |
| operator()(int x, int y, int z, int c) const | lsseg::Image< double > | [inline] |
| operator+=(const Image< double > &rhs) | lsseg::Image< double > | [inline] |
| operator+=(doublea) | lsseg::Image< double > | [inline] |
| operator-=(const Image< double > &rhs) | lsseg::Image< double > | [inline] |
| operator-=(doublea) | lsseg::Image< double > | [inline] |
| operator/=(doublea) | lsseg::Image< double > | [inline] |
| operator=(const Image< double > &rhs) | lsseg::LevelSetFunction | [inline, virtual] |
| operator=(const double &val) | lsseg::LevelSetFunction | [inline, virtual] |
| operator[](unsigned int ix) | lsseg::Image< double > | [inline] |
| operator[](unsigned int ix) const | lsseg::Image< double > | [inline] |
| permute(const int *const perm) | lsseg::LevelSetFunction | [inline, virtual] |
| read(std::istream &is, bool binary=true) | lsseg::LevelSetFunction | [inline, virtual] |
| reinitialize2D(const Mask *mask=0) | lsseg::LevelSetFunction | |
| reinitialize3D(const Mask *mask=0) | lsseg::LevelSetFunction | |
| resize(const LevelSetFunction &rhs) | lsseg::LevelSetFunction | [inline] |
| resize(int x, int y, int z=1, int channels=1) | lsseg::LevelSetFunction | [inline, virtual] |
| lsseg::Image< double >::resize(const Image< U > &rhs) | lsseg::Image< double > | [inline] |
| setAbsolute() | lsseg::Image< double > | [inline] |
| single_channel_assert(int num_chan) | lsseg::LevelSetFunction | [inline, private] |
| size() const | lsseg::Image< double > | [inline] |
| size_compatible(const Image< U > &rhs) const | lsseg::Image< double > | [inline] |
| spatial_compatible(const Image< U > &rhs) const | lsseg::Image< double > | [inline] |
| superpose(const Image< double > &img) | lsseg::Image< double > | [inline] |
| swap(Image< double > &rhs) | lsseg::LevelSetFunction | [inline, virtual] |
| value_type typedef | lsseg::Image< double > | |
| write(std::ostream &os, bool binary=true) const | lsseg::Image< double > | [inline] |
| ~Image() | lsseg::Image< double > | [inline, virtual] |
| ~LevelSetFunction() | lsseg::LevelSetFunction | [inline, virtual] |